Materials:
* Phillips screwdriver
* Flat head screwdriver
Steps:
1. Disconnect the negative terminal of the battery. This will prevent short circuit.
2. Remove the air conditioner control panel.
— Pry up the sides of the control panel using a flat-head screwdriver.
— Disconnect the electrical connectors at the rear of the panel.
3. Remove the upper part of the center console.
— Remove the two Phillips screws at the top of the console, near the air conditioning control panel.
— Gently pull the top of the console up and remove it.
4. Remove the gearshift frame.
— Remove the two Phillips screws at the bottom of the frame.
— Gently pull the frame up and remove it.
5. Remove the lower part of the center console.
— Remove the four Phillips screws on the sides and bottom of the bottom of the console.
— Disconnect the electrical connectors at the rear of the console.
— Gently pull the bottom of the console up and remove it.
6. Disconnect the wiring from the center console.
— Disconnect any remaining electrical connectors from the rear of the center console.
Installation:
Follow the same steps in reverse to install the center console.
